在数字化浪潮席卷全球的今天,计算机网络已成为社会运转的基石。成为一名优秀的网络工程师,不仅意味着掌握高薪技能,更是肩负着保障信息流通、维护网络安全的重要责任。这条修炼之路,需要系统的知识、持续的实践与不断演进的思维。
第一阶段:夯实理论基础,构建知识体系
卓越的工程能力始于扎实的理论根基。一名合格的网络工程师必须深入理解计算机网络的核心原理。
- 掌握网络模型与协议: 精读TCP/IP协议族和OSI七层模型,理解从物理层(如线缆、接口)到应用层(如HTTP、DNS)每一层的功能、协议与数据封装过程。这是分析一切网络问题的逻辑起点。
- 精通IP寻址与子网划分: IPv4/IPv6地址规划、子网划分、VLSM(可变长子网掩码)和CIDR(无类域间路由)是网络设计的核心技能,必须达到熟练计算与规划的水平。
- 理解路由与交换原理: 深入学习静态路由、动态路由协议(如OSPF, EIGRP, BGP)的工作原理与配置,以及交换机上的VLAN、STP、以太网通道等关键二层技术。
第二阶段:拥抱实践操作,获取权威认证
理论需在实践中检验和升华。实验室环境与真实项目是成长的催化剂。
- 搭建实验环境: 利用GNS3、EVE-NG或Packet Tracer等仿真工具,亲手搭建、配置和调试复杂的网络拓扑。从简单的局域网互联,到多区域OSPF、BGP广域网互联,反复练习直至形成肌肉记忆。
- 考取行业认证: 认证是知识体系的结构化与证明。建议遵循经典路径:思科的CCNA(入门)→ CCNP(进阶)→ CCIE(专家),或华为的HCIA→HCIP→HCIE。备考过程本身就是一次高强度、系统性的学习。
- 接触真实设备: 争取机会操作真实的交换机、路由器、防火墙等设备,了解命令行界面(CLI)的细节与设备硬件特性,感受与模拟器的细微差别。
第三阶段:深化专业领域,培养解决方案思维
在通晓基础网络之后,需根据兴趣与市场需求,向纵深发展。
- 选择专精方向: 网络安全(如防火墙策略、入侵检测、VPN)、无线网络(如企业级WLAN设计与优化)、数据中心网络(如SDN、VXLAN、FabricPath)或运营商网络等,选择一个领域深入钻研,成为该领域的专家。
- 学习自动化与编程: 现代网络运维正向“基础设施即代码”演进。学习Python、Ansible等工具,实现网络设备的自动化配置、监控与运维,极大提升效率并减少人为错误。这是区分普通工程师与优秀工程师的关键能力。
- 培养综合解决方案能力: 优秀工程师不应只关注设备配置。要学会分析业务需求,设计高可用、可扩展、安全的网络架构,并能综合考虑成本、性能与运维复杂度,提供整体解决方案。
第四阶段:锤炼软技能,实现终身成长
技术深度决定下限,综合素养决定上限。
- 强化排错能力: 建立系统化的排错思路(如分层法、对比法、替换法),熟练使用Wireshark、ping、traceroute、SNMP等分析工具。冷静、逻辑清晰地从现象追溯到根源,是工程师价值的直接体现。
- 提升沟通与文档能力: 能够清晰地向非技术人员解释技术问题,撰写严谨的技术方案、变更报告与拓扑文档。团队协作与跨部门沟通同样至关重要。
- 保持持续学习热情: 网络技术日新月异(如5G、物联网、云网络、SASE)。通过阅读技术博客(如思科社区、华为官网)、关注行业动态、参与技术论坛,建立持续学习的习惯,方能与时俱进。
****
修炼成一名优秀的网络工程师,是一场融合了理论学习、动手实践、专业深化与素养提升的马拉松。它没有捷径,唯有怀揣对网络世界的好奇与热忱,脚踏实地,从每一行命令、每一次排错、每一次设计中积累经验。当你能从容地设计、构建并维护起支撑关键业务运行的神经网络时,你便真正步入了优秀工程师的行列。这条路,始于一个IP地址的梦想,通往的是无限广阔的数字未来。